How long ago did his brother get TFs, and what age? Transformers have come a long way since G1 and often use ball joints and other parts that snap off and easily snap on rather than result in permanent damage. Timing's also a factor as newer TF lines are trickling out right now and include some designs I think are a tad more kid-friendly than some stuff on the shelves.

Anything from the Fast Action Battlers subline would work just fine however, as they're simplified in transformation without looking like Playskool or something else obviously kiddified. The Movie Activators line would also work perfectly, but that's also one of those newer toylines that you might not find readily yet. Toys'R'Us would be the best bet for those.
